摘要
In this paper, a concept of utility proportional fairness is defined, which achieves fairness of utility for different applications. The optimization problem of utility proportional fairness has been formulated meanwhile the optimal solution is presented. The utility proportional fairness is applied in the orthogonal frequency division multiplexing (OFDM) wireless networks, and the optimal subcarrier allocation for utility proportional fairness is deduced. An effective and practical simplified subcarrier allocation algorithm is proposed, in which the instantaneous data rate is substituted by average rate via exponentially weighted low pass time window. Simulation results illustrate that both the optimal and simplified subcarrier allocation algorithms guarantee the utility fairness between different applications well, and the simplified algorithm achieves a perfect tradeoff between utility fairness and system throughput and provides the quality of server (QoS) for multimedia applications.
